The Comfytemp 24’’ x 12’’ Red Light Therapy Pad features 242 dual-chip LEDs emitting 660nm visible red and 850nm near-infrared light at 32W power. Its large flexible design covers multiple body parts, enhanced by a hands-free strap and intuitive controls with 4 modes and 3 intensity levels. Perfect for daily 20-minute sessions, it supports muscle relaxation, joint pain relief, and skin health, making advanced light therapy accessible and convenient for professionals and active lifestyles.

Large, Effective, and Worth The Price
This was worth every penny of the purchase price! I use this pad several times a week and would use it more if I could fit it into my schedule. The size is great for near full body coverage. It can be set for 3 different power (low, medium, high) and 4 different light settings (Near Infra, Infra, Combination, and Pulse). It automatically shuts off after 20 minutes, so I don't have to watch the clock. I use it for 20 minutes on my back, then turn over for 20 more. After about a month of use, I'm seeing no issues with the pad's performance. I do wipe it down with a soft dry towel after each use. On the highest setting, it does get a little warm, but not hot by any means. The plastic is comfortable to lay on and doesn't seem to cause sweating and it folds up for easy storage under the bed. I do notice a reduction in inflammation when there is an injury, muscle recovery after workouts, and it does often make me feel a little sleepy on the highest settings, which isn't really a complaint. Read the instructions and use it responsibly for best results.
